Burning software on laptop, DVD burner on desktop

I need to burn recovery discs for my Thinkpad X61, but it doesn't have an optical drive.

The default option would be to purchase/borrow a USB DVD burner. I don't know anyone who has one, and I'd rather not buy it for a one-time use.

Is there any way of burning a DVD over with a DVD drive shared on my home network? Rescue and Recovery (the Lenovo software) will need to see it as a local DVD drive.
